Philip Russell Goodwin (1882-1935), American

MEN OF METTLE (ALSO CALLED DEEP WATER LOGGING), CIRCA 1932

Oil on canvas; signed lower right, titled “Men of Mettle” to the top stretcher in pencil, further titled “Deep Water/ 5 col” in crayon verso and inscribed again ”Deep Water Logging/ 5 col sfx/ I saw June 18th” in a circle in crayon to the canvas and inscribed indistinctly verso
24" x 33" — 61 x 83.8 cm.

Estimate $75,000-$100,000

Realised: $77,250

Provenance:

Ex. Coll. Rolph-Clark-Stone Ltd., Toronto, ON, until 1969;
Acquired from the above by the present Prominent Private Collection, Canada, circa 1969;
By descent

Literature:

Larry Len Peterson, Philip R. Goodwin American’s Sporting & Wildlife Artist, the title cited on p. 201; Illustrated in colour p. 250, No. 3.90, as a Calendar cover for Waukon Lumber Company, Waukon, IA, USA, for 1932 as “Men of Mettle” (Patricia and Charlie Johnston Collection)

Note:

In the 1930s Goodwin’s logging scenes appeared on a series of calendars, including this work featuring one logger in a red plaid shirt executed circa 1932.
